(05-25-2013, 04:01 AM)JustSiDEwayZ Wrote: Looking pretty good Steve, for a noob to cs! Looking really good for a rear mount AE TC5! Only thing I seen was the front seemed to pull you out kinda easy on some transitions. An the rear is kicking kinda hard on throttle. But its just what I got from watching. You could try to lessen your preloads all the way around by a half to full turn. It might also just be a slightly grippy tire. Looking good tho man keep it up. As you drive more and develop your skills. The tuning will become easier to understand.
